    ACL in front of CM

    I used to be able to allow host or networks, now I'm being tasked with only allowing the specific ports and protocols. I think this ACL allows everything Avaya uses.
    Thoughts?

    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any eq 1039
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any eq 2945
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any eq 1956
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any range 5005 5220
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any eq 5424
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any range 5060 5080
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any range 7007 7011
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any eq 8765
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any eq 9000
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any eq 12080
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any range 20873 21874
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x.0.0.0.0 any range 59000 59200
    permit tcp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x 0.0.0.0 any range 1719 1720
    permit udp x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x.0.0.0.0 any gt 2048
